What is the living part of an ecosystem called?​

Chemistry
2 answers:
Ulleksa [173]4 years ago
5 0
Biotic factors, the non living would be abiotic factors

As the pressure on a gas confined above a liquid increases, the solubility of the gas in the liquid
Gelneren [198K]
As the pressure on the on a gas cofined above a liquid increases, the solubility of the gas will increase

this also happen when we lower the temperature
